Roweth, Barbara – Studies in Higher Education, 1987
Results of a British survey of full-time employed, part-time master's students in various fields of science and technology are used to examine the characteristics of this group, their patterns of financial support, distances traveled to attend class, employment patterns, and the perceived costs and benefits of combining study and employment. Penna, Richard P.; Sherman, Michael S. – American Journal of Pharmaceutical Education, 1988
Data from a national survey of pharmacy schools include institutional enrollments by degree level, specialization, student status (full- or part-time), gender, ethnic group, and year of study (first, second, third, fourth). Trends since 1980 are also charted. (MSE)
